HB 349·NC·house
Modify Health Care Powers of Attorney/Advance Directives.

Summary
The bill revises the statutes that govern health‑care powers of attorney and advance directives, specifying how they must be signed, witnessed, or notarized. It also authorizes the Secretary of State to accept electronic copies of these documents. The changes aim to make the forms easier to use while protecting against conflicts of interest.
